Job Title Project Controls, Senior Project Engineer – Project FarmaLocation Boston, MAEmployment Type Full‑time salaried positionOverview This role is fully billable and works collaboratively with clients, vendors, contractors, and other Project Farma team members to support biomanufacturing projects across the entire engineering lifecycle. The successful candidate will reside in the Boston, MA market and be willing to travel domestically.Key Responsibilities Produce key project controls deliverables, including: Budget estimatesDetailed project schedules and milestonesFeasibility estimates, risks, forecasts, and scenario analysisProject cost reports and trend analysisComprehensive monthly project summary reportsAnalyze complex project data and deliver clear, articulate, and concise messages to support decision making.Gain a general understanding of Earned Value Analysis and PO management tools.Update internal site tools such as site dashboards, deliverable trackers, etc.Examples of core services within the life science space: Capital Project Management (including Project Controls and Scheduling)Facility Management & buildsTech TransfersValidation Life Cycle (including Commissioning, Qualification, Process Validation)Computer System Validation, GxP Automated Systems, Due Diligence & Business Strategy, Quality, Regulatory & ComplianceRequired Experience and Qualifications Bachelor's Degree in Life Science, Engineering, or related discipline and/or comparable military experience.Proficiency in Microsoft Excel; knowledge of Smartsheet and/or Microsoft Project is a plus.Full‑time on‑site client presence required.Willingness to travel domestically as required to support project and business needs.Applicants must be authorized to work in the United States on a full‑time basis; no visa sponsorship will be provided.Position may require significant travel to support project and business needs.Valid driver's license required.Equal Employment Opportunity PerkinElmer is committed to creating a diverse environment and is proud to be an equal opportunity employer. At PerkinElmer, we design, manufacture and deliver advanced technology solutions that address the world's most critical health and safety concerns, including maternal and fetal health, clean water and air, and safe food and toys.

Our expertise combines science, innovation and a culture of operational excellence to offer our customers technology services and support that improve the quality of people's lives worldwide.

A Leader in Human Health
Whether it's testing newborns for life-threatening disorders, supporting scientists in finding better cures, or helping doctors treat disease, our focus on human health extends beyond the lab and into hospitals and homes. With our innovative screenings and treatments, and our ongoing development of advanced life science tools, we help generate earlier medical insights, more accurate results, and more effective therapies.

A Leader in Environmental Health
Our work in environmental health improves the quality and sustainability of our environment, and the security of people in the places where we live, work and play. This includes providing the analytical instrumentation, and services that ensure clean air and water; safe food and consumer products; and efficient, renewable energy - the essential components of a healthier, safer today and tomorrow.
